Greetings

English Chadian Arabic
c Salâm alêk
general greeting to a woman Salâm alêki
general greeting to a group Salâm alêku
general greeting to a man Al-salâm alêk
general greeting to a woman Al-salâm alêki
general greeting to a group Al-salâm alêkum
reply to Al-salâm alĂŞk, Al-salâm alĂŞki, and Al-salâm alĂŞkum Wa alĂŞk al-salâm
informal greeting (from Kanuri) Lâlê
informal greeting spoken to a man LâlĂŞk
informal greeting spoken to a woman LâlĂŞki
informal greeting spoken to a group LâlĂŞku
informal greeting (from Fulfulde) Use
morning greeting Asbahta Ă˘fe
morning greeting Sbah l xĂŞr
afternoon greeting M'sel xĂŞr
evening greeting AmsĂŞtu Ă˘fe
nighttime greeting Asbuhu ale l xĂŞr
how are you? Kēfin nak?
how are you? Kēf ahal
reply to Kēf ahal Afe, alhamdulilah
how are you? Kēf ḥalkun?
how are you? are you healthy? spoken to a man Inta Ă˘fe?
how are you? are you healthy? spoken to a woman Inti Ă˘fe?
how are you? are you healthy? spoken to a group Intu Ă˘fe?
how are you? are you healthy? spoken to a group Intu Ă˘fe wallâ?
reply to Inta Ă˘fe, Inti Ă˘fe, and Intu Ă˘fe Ana Ă˘fe
reply to Inta Ă˘fe, Inti Ă˘fe, and Intu Ă˘fe Âfe
how are you? is everyone helathy? Taybin?
reply to Taybin Aywâ, taybin
welcome greeting spoken to a man JĂŽtan jĂŽt
welcome greeting spoken to a woman JĂŽtan jĂŽti
welcome greeting spoken to a group JĂŽtan jĂŽtu
welcome greeting MabrĂşk al-jayye
